Page 0 / Register 86 (0x56): AGC Control 1
READ/ RESET
BIT DESCRIPTION
WRITE VALUE
D7 R/W 0 0: AGC disabled
1: AGC enabled
D6–D4 R/W 000 000: AGC target level = 5.5 dB
001: AGC target level = –8 dB
010: AGC target level = –10 dB
011: AGC target level = –12 dB
100: AGC target level = –14 dB
101: AGC target level = –17 dB
110: AGC target level = –20 dB
111: AGC target level = –24 dB
D3–D0 R/W 0000 Reserved. Write only zeros to these bits.
Page 0 / Register 87 (0x57): AGC Control 2
READ/ RESET
BIT DESCRIPTION
WRITE VALUE
D7–D6 R/W 00 00: AGC hysteresis setting of 1 dB
01: AGC hysteresis setting of 2 dB
10: AGC hysteresis setting of 4 dB
11: AGC hysteresis disabled
D5–D1 R/W 00 000 00 000: AGC noise/silence detection is disabled.
00 001: AGC noise threshold = –30 dB
00 010: AGC noise threshold = –32 dB
00 011: AGC noise threshold = –34 dB
...
11 101: AGC noise threshold = –86 dB
11 110: AGC noise threshold = –88 dB
11 111: AGC noise threshold = –90 dB
D0 R/W 0 Reserved. Write only zero to this bit.
Page 0 / Register 88 (0x58): AGC Maximum Gain
READ/ RESET
BIT DESCRIPTION
WRITE VALUE
D7 R/W 0 Reserved. Write only zero to this bit.
D6–D0 R/W 111 1111 000 0000: AGC maximum gain = 0 dB
000 0001: AGC maximum gain = 0.5 dB
000 0010: AGC maximum gain = 1 dB
...
111 0011: AGC maximum gain = 57.5 dB
111 0100: AGC maximum gain = 58 dB
111 0101: AGC maximum gain = 58.5 dB
111 0110: AGC maximum gain = 59 dB
111 0111: AGC maximum gain = 59.5 dB
111 1000–111 1111: Reserved. Do not write these sequences to these bits.
